One of two EPs from the Sheffield-based man of mystery Beneath. With ruthlessly stark sound design, it's difficult to categorise this in any other way but 'heavy'. Four-to-the-floor beats, early dubstep darkness, UK-funky swing, techno-flavoured minimalism, it's all in the melting pot, and it's well worth investigating. There are four tracks in total, each one of a similar, addictively mixable flavour; the highlight for us on this EP was "Trouble" thanks to its cheeky reverberated 8-bit skank in the background. That said, the raw tribal elements to the beats on the title track were an instant hook for us too. Check it and find out yourselves.
